Famous Afrobeat artist Davido got into a heated argument with an Abuja-based barber after the two of them exchanged angry messages on social media about what appeared to be an innocent post.

Davido started the situation by posting pictures of himself on his Instagram profile and inviting his admirers to meet him in a location in the United Arab Emirates.

“HABIBI COME TO DUBAI !!!!!,” Davido wrote.

What happened next, though, was surprising as Kallystouch, an Abuja barber, chose to poke fun at the performer in the comments area.

The singer appeared to take exception at Kallystouch’s remark that Davido was the “only third man in the music industry.”

Davido snapped back, saying he was disappointed in Kallystouch’s actions, especially since he had kept the barber’s contact information in the hopes of using his services in the future.

Davido responded by emphasising how he had previously helped his barbers by opening stores for them and lamented what he saw as a lost chance for Kallystouch to gain from his support.

The conversation became more heated as Davido bemoaned the fact that Kallystouch seemed to value social media more than taking advantage of opportunities to further his profession.

“I don save ur picture I for come Abuja … u for cut my hair wey don almost finish but u like social media … my last 3 barbers I open shop for them .. nah so u dull ur generation blessing smh,” Davido responded.

Kallystouch, unfazed by Davido’s retort, used his Instagram story to reiterate his commitment to Wizkid. Referring to himself as a part of the Wizkid FC (Football Club), he claimed that no amount of pressure from Davido or his supporters could make him change his mind.

“Davido no be my God, FC forever. I am a Wizkid FC Barber 1 period,” he wrote.
